Transaction ecc8d7da858a85e0090dfeb94de7f909657a35419ea099c6113c822fb75e8e91
1 Input
1 Output
-
ecc8d7da858a85e0090dfeb94de7f909657a35419ea099c6113c822fb75e8e91:0
- value
- 390000
- script pubkey
- OP_0 OP_PUSHBYTES_20 34db1f0fc495e37870341449a59171fbadfcc27a
- address
- bc1qxnd37r7yjh3hsup5z3y6tyt3lwklesn6vc4w9r